renderer.setClearColor( 0xffffff, 1 ); 
我应该帮你。第一个参数是RGB中的背景色,第二个参数是alpha。例如:

renderer.setClearColor( 0xff0000, .5 ); 
这应该将渲染背景设置为红色,透明度为50%。我自己刚开始玩three.js,所以我希望这对你有用

编辑::现在我已经有超过一秒钟的时间了,我已经在你的代码笔中尝试过了。在初始化渲染器之后,我立即在init()函数中添加了上面这一行,它就工作了
